This role will be responsible for establishing and strengthening the organization's internal audit, internal financial controls (IFC), risk management, and governance frameworks. It will provide independent assurance on the effectiveness of internal controls, risk mitigation measures, and compliance with statutory and regulatory requirements. Working closely with business leaders, the incumbent will identify control gaps, recommend process improvements, monitor implementation of corrective actions, and enhance the overall control environment.
Internal Audit Strategy & Assurance
- Develop and implement the annual risk-based internal audit plan, ensuring comprehensive coverage of financial, operational, compliance, and strategic risks.
- Ensure timely execution of audit engagements through internal and external audit partners in line with the approved audit calendar.
- Oversee the quality and effectiveness of audit reviews and ensure timely issuance of audit reports with actionable recommendations.
- Strengthen the internal audit framework to meet statutory requirements and support effective governance.
Internal Controls & Governance
- Design, implement, and continuously enhance the organization's Internal Financial Controls (IFC) and operational control framework.
- Establish and maintain comprehensive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), control matrices, and governance frameworks across business functions.
- Periodically assess the adequacy and effectiveness of internal controls and recommend improvements to strengthen the control environment.
- Review and update internal control policies in line with business requirements, regulatory changes, and industry best practices.
Risk Management & Control Assurance
- Identify control gaps, process inefficiencies, and operational risks, and drive implementation of corrective and preventive actions by co-creating solutions with business units.
- Build a robust control assurance framework by partnering with functional teams to embed risk ownership and accountability.
- Monitor the implementation and effectiveness of audit recommendations and report the status of corrective actions.
- Lead the organization's fraud risk management framework, including fraud prevention, detection, investigation, and monitoring mechanisms.
Regulatory Compliance & Corporate Governance
- Assess the effectiveness of the organization's regulatory compliance framework and recommend improvements where required.
- Ensure compliance with the Companies Act, Internal Financial Controls (IFC) requirements, and other applicable regulatory and governance standards.
- Support statutory, internal, and regulatory audits by providing relevant documentation, insights, and assurance regarding the effectiveness of internal controls.
- Promote a culture of ethics, compliance, and accountability across the organization.
Reporting & Stakeholder Management
- Prepare and present periodic audit and risk reports, including key observations, risk assessments, and remediation status, to the CFO and CEO.
- Provide independent assurance to senior management and the Audit Committee on the effectiveness of governance, risk management, and internal control processes.
- Engage with business leaders to provide advisory support on governance, process improvements, and risk mitigation initiatives.
- Liaise with external auditors, statutory auditors, and regulatory authorities on audit and compliance matters.
Continuous Improvement, Transformation & Innovation
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ives by strengthening governance, simplifying processes, and enhancing the organization's control environment through standardized and efficient practices.
- Lead the adoption of digital transformation, automation, data analytics, and AI-enabled solutions to improve audit effectiveness, risk identification, control monitoring, and decision-making.
- Benchmark governance, risk management, and internal audit practices against industry best practices and implement innovative solutions to enhance organizational effectiveness and control maturity.
- Foster a culture of innovation, continuous learning, and technology-enabled assurance by promoting the use of emerging technologies to proactively address business risks, improve operational efficiency, and support strategic objectives.
